Soul
Soul food describes food traditionally eaten by African Americans of the Southern United States, and includes chitterlings, ham hocks, and collard greens.

Korea has its own cuisine, quite different from Chinese or Japanese. Rice is the staple food and a typical Korean meal consists of rice, soup, rice water and 8-20 side dishes of vegetables, fish, poultry, eggs, bean curd and sea plants.
